This function applies the L-method (Salvador and Chan, 2005) for the estimation of the appropriate number of clusters on an evaluation graph.
This software has been created and used by the author in the papers:
[1] A. Zagouras, R.H. Inman, C.F.M. Coimbra, On the determination of coherent solar microclimates for utility planning and operations, Solar Energy, Volume 102, April 2014, Pages 173-188, ISSN 0038-092X, http://dx.doi.org/10.1016/j.solener.2014.01.021.
[2] A. Zagouras, A. Kazantzidis, E. Nikitidou, A.A. Argiriou, Determination of measuring sites for solar irradiance, based on cluster analysis of satellite-derived cloud estimations, Solar Energy, Volume 97, November 2013, Pages 1-11, ISSN 0038-092X, http://dx.doi.org/10.1016/j.solener.2013.08.005.
